Foods that could bind up microplastics:
- okra, molokhiyya, yamaimo/mountain yam, nopal/prickly pear, malabar spinach, and similar mucilaginous foods
- kimchi, sauerkraut, and other lacto-fermented foods
- pectins such as citrus or apple pectin (also found in jams, stewed fruits and applesauce)
- flax, chia, and psyllium
